At CIAT, our Cybersecurity Program prepares you to take charge in today's digitally driven world through three core learning outcomes:
- Organize the usage of proper security planning, concerns, issues, and risk assessment using NIST, ISO, modern security policies, and best practices.
- Develop security solutions using available technology to prevent or discover vulnerabilities and exploits within enterprise systems.
- Successfully critique existing security measures for weaknesses in design and implementation using current and new unfolding security threats.

How many of my previous college credits can I transfer?
CIAT accepts up to 75% of eligible credits earned from previous institutions, including community colleges, technical schools, and 4-year universities. Our admissions team will evaluate your official transcripts to determine how many credits can be transferred to your desired program.
What types of credits can I transfer?
In addition to standard college coursework, we also accept credits earned through military training, industry certifications, and general education platforms like CLEP, Straighterline, and Sofia Learning. We aim to help you maximize the value of your past educational investments.
How quickly can I get a transfer credit evaluation?
We understand the importance of timely assessment of your eligible transfer credits. That's why our transfer credit evaluation process is fast and efficient, usually completed within 24-48 hours of receiving your transcripts.

What type of military tuition assistance and benefits does CIAT accept?
CIAT proudly offers military tuition assistance and benefits to service members in the Army, Navy, Marines, Air Force, and Coast Guard. This includes GI Bill® benefits, Veteran Readiness & Employment (VR&E), VA STEM Scholarship, VA Yellow Ribbon Program, Active Duty Tuition Assistance, MyCAA Scholarship Programs, and more. Our financial aid experts will work with you to maximize your available funding.
Do I need to attend classes on campus as a military student?
We understand the challenges of attending in-person classes for active duty and deployed service members. That's why we offer a Hybrid Campus Plan, where you only need to attend your final exam session at our National City campus. All other coursework can be completed 100% online.

What are the requirements for re-enrollment consideration?
<p>The re-enrollment process includes:</p>
<ol class="flex flex-col gap-4">
<li>1. Schedule an appointment with an admissions representative to discuss your renewed academic goals.</li>
<li>2. Completing a new enrollment application and signing the Gainful Employment Disclosures.</li>
<li>3. Submitting a 250-word essay detailing your goals, how CIAT can help you achieve them, and how you'll address any previous obstacles.</li>
<li>4. Completing a formal interview with the Director of Admissions.</li>
</ol>
How is the re-enrollment decision made?
The CIAT management team will review your re-admission application, previous academic history, attendance, and reason for departure. Each case is evaluated individually - prior admission does not guarantee re-admission. The final decision will be made in writing within 10 business days.
What happens if I'm approved for re-enrollment?
If your re-enrollment is approved, any coursework you completed with a grade of "C" or better will be transferred to your new enrollment if you re-enroll within 12 months of your withdrawal.
Are there any exceptions for active-duty military students?
Yes. Suppose you're an active-duty service member who had to withdraw due to deployment or other service requirements. In that case, we'll waive the formal re-admission interview and essay steps to make the process easier for your transition back.
